Spigot Switch Assembly Installation
26126
Figure 121
The Flavor Burst system is activated by a
switch, either an external one mounted to the
draw handle or an internal one already installed
inside your freezer. Most freezers have this
internal switch which is located under the face
ledge near the draw spout. (See Figure 121.)
If
your freezer has this switch, skip this section
and proceed to the “Keypad and Keypad
Mounting Bracket Installation”.
If your freezer does not have an internal switch,
a draw switch must be mounted to the handle.
The FB 80M system ships with a standard
Spigot Switch Assembly common to most
freezers with flat handle bars. Should your
freezer have a round handle rod or a handle of
unusual size or shape, this standard switch is
not be suitable for your freezer model. Contact
your local distributor if the Spigot Switch
included with your unit does not fit.
1. For freezers with a flat draw-handle bar, an
external switch assembly is included with
this unit. To install this Spigot Switch
assembly, simply clip the Switch Bracket
onto the handle and slide it up the handle
until the switch is within grasping range.
(See Figure 122.)
